\name{plot_var_compare}
\alias{plot_var_compare}
\title{Plot matching heatmaps for modeled and observed temp}
\usage{
plot_var_compare(nc_file, field_file, var_name, fig_path = FALSE,
resample = TRUE, col_lim, ...)
}
\arguments{
\item{nc_file}{Netcdf model output file}
\item{field_file}{CSV or TSV field data file (see \link{resample_to_field} for format)}
\item{var_name}{a character vector of valid variable names (see \code{\link{sim_vars}})}
\item{fig_path}{F if plot to screen, string path if save plot as .png}
\item{resample}{sample the model output to the same time points as the observations?}
\item{col_lim}{range for heatmap (in units of the variable)}
\item{\dots}{additional arguments passed to \code{\link{resample_to_field}}}
}
\examples{
sim_folder <- run_example_sim(verbose = FALSE)
nc_file <- file.path(sim_folder, 'output.nc')
nml_file <- file.path(sim_folder, 'glm2.nml')
field_file <- file.path(sim_folder, 'field_data.tsv')
run_glm(sim_folder)
plot_var_compare(nc_file, field_file, 'temp', resample=FALSE) ##makes a plot!
}
\seealso{
Internally uses \link{get_var} and \link{resample_to_field}
}
